In quantum mechanics, an excited state of a system (such as an atom, molecule or nucleus) is any quantum state of the system that has a higher energy than the ground state (that is, more energy than the absolute minimum). Excitation refers to an increase in energy level above a chosen starting point, … Zobacz więcej Atoms can be excited by heat, electricity, or light. A simple example of this concept comes by considering the hydrogen atom.
